Emma Watson and Rupert Grint’s reunion in Harry Potter: Return to Hogwarts has left fans in tears. 

The trailer for the series, which has been created to celebrate 20 years since the release of the first film, sees the pair reminisce about their time together on set. 

At one point, Grint can be seen taking Watson’s hand and saying: “It’s a strong bond that we’ll always have.”

Fans were quick to share their thoughts on the heart-warming moment.

One wrote: “The first movie couple that I was rooting for. Ron and Hermione, Emma and Rupert played them perfectly. My heart is melting.” 

“I just saw this image and my Hermione/Ron shipping heart just melted,” said another.

A third person commented: “I know this isn’t supposed to be Ron and Hermione but it looks like them, I’m sorry. Romione is my OTP [one true pairing].” 

Singer Ariana Grande even joined in and shared a clip of the touching moment on her Instagram story alongside the caption: “Help me.” 

The trailer also shows fan favourites Daniel Radcliffe, Helena Bonham Carter, Tom Felton, and Bonnie Wright all return to discuss what the famous franchise means to them.
